INTERNAL MEMO — Office Manager

Re: Replacement lock for the records safe

The new lock assembly for the Fenwright-series safe in Room 2 has arrived from Coldharbor Security Works. It is boxed, tamper-taped, and stored in the locked cabinet pending installation on Friday. Please verify the tape is intact each morning and note it in the log. The old mechanism must stay in place until the installer signs off. A courier will collect the decommissioned lock the same afternoon; the hand-over instruction is set out below.

handover note for bajog-tawig: the lamion quenael courier leaves the wendor ledger at gate 1289 under passcode 760784

## Deployment

The Murdock thumbnail queue runs as a single worker pool behind the Ostrell broker. Deploy by pushing the image and restarting the pool; in-flight jobs are requeued automatically. Do not scale above four workers — the image store rate-limits and jobs will thrash. Failed thumbnails land in the retry bucket with a three-attempt cap. Logs go to the shared sink under the worker hostname. On boot, each worker reads the following configuration.

deployment values, bafog-yaguf:
[julvan]
team = praix
access_code = ac_0696c8
host = julvan.sivrelsoft.corp
port = 5000
owner = casvan.novix
peer = aldix.zemvartech.example

## Revised Commission Scheme — Restricted: Managers

Effective next quarter, the Denholt commission model replaces flat-rate payouts with tiered accelerators: 6% base, rising to 11% above 120% of target. Renewals on the Quorail product line count at half weight. Clawbacks apply to cancellations within 90 days. Please review the strategic context appended immediately below before briefing your teams.

internal memo for hahaf-bajef: Headcount on the Zorael team goes from 7 to 140 by the end of July. Gross margin on Zorael came in at 15 percent against a plan of 15 percent.